    Enter the Dragon This appearance also earned Kelly a three-film contract with Warner Brothers and led to starring roles in a string of martial arts-themed blaxploitation films. [ 14 ] The first was Black Belt Jones (1974), [ 15 ] in which he plays a local hero who fights the Mafia and a drug dealer threatening his friend's dojo.

    In 1973, he appeared as the henchman "Bolo" in Bruce Lee's Enter the Dragon, which catapulted him to international fame. [6] Throughout the 1970s and 80s he appeared in many Bruceploitation films, including The Clones of Bruce Lee (1977) and Enter the Game of Death (1978). He made his directorial debut in 1977 with the film Fists of Justice. [7]

    Enter the Drag Dragon is a Canadian action comedy film, directed by Lee Demarbre and released in 2023. [1] Billed as "world’s first ever drag queen, martial arts, comedy", the film centres on Crunch, a drag queen and amateur detective in Ottawa who is drawn into a strange criminal underworld of construction goons, anti-gay Christian vigilantes and an Aztec mummy, when asked by a client to ...

    Anna Marie Nanasi (July 6, 1944 – August 19, 2010), better known by her professional name Ahna Capri (also as Anna Capri), was a Hungarian-American film and television actress best known for her role as Tania (secretary of Han) in the martial-arts film Enter the Dragon.
